示例#1
0
        public void Deveria_Remover_Aula_SQL_Test()
        {
            AulaRepository.Delete(1);

            var aulasEncontradas = AulaRepository.GetAll();

            Uow.Commit();

            Assert.IsTrue(aulasEncontradas.Count == 0);
        }
示例#2
0
        public bool Delete(long id)
        {
            if (_aulaRepository.Get(id).Cursadas.Any())
            {
                return(false);
            }

            _aulaRepository.Delete(id);

            return(true);
        }
示例#3
0
        public void Deveria_Remover_Aula_ORM_Test()
        {
            AulaRepository.Add(new Aula());

            Uow.Commit();

            var aulasEncontradas = AulaRepository.GetAll();

            Assert.IsTrue(aulasEncontradas.Count == 2);

            AulaRepository.Delete(1);

            Uow.Commit();

            aulasEncontradas = AulaRepository.GetAll();

            Assert.IsTrue(aulasEncontradas.Count == 1);
        }
示例#4
0
 public void Delete(long id)
 {
     _aulaRepository.Delete(id);
 }